Advanced Installer is a Windows software installation authoring tool that creates MSI packages and supports features like upgrading existing installations, 64-bit support, multi-language support, custom actions, conditional statements, and integrating with source control.

Makeself is a small shell script that generates a self-extractable tarball for Unix. It packages software into a single executable file for easy distribution and installation.
